Michael Bajura is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Human-Computer Interaction and Aerospace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Michael Bajura has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 812 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, 4 papers in Human-Computer Interaction and 3 papers in Aerospace Engineering. Recurrent topics in Michael Bajura's work include Augmented Reality Applications (6 papers), Interactive and Immersive Displays (4 papers) and Robotics and Sensor-Based Localization (3 papers). Michael Bajura is often cited by papers focused on Augmented Reality Applications (6 papers), Interactive and Immersive Displays (4 papers) and Robotics and Sensor-Based Localization (3 papers). Michael Bajura collaborates with scholars based in United States. Michael Bajura's co-authors include Ryutarou Ohbuchi, Henry Fuchs, Ulrich Neumann, Andrei State, David Chen, Hong Chen and A. Brandt and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Computer Graphics and Applications and ACM SIGGRAPH Computer Graphics.
